    Please consider submitting an abstract by April 1 (tomorrow!) for the 2020 AIA/ACSA Intersections Research Conference.

    The American Institute of Architects and Association of Collegiate Schools of Architecture have launched this new series of conferences focused on how academics and practitioners generate architectural research to address societal challenges. The first - scheduled for October 1-3, 2020 in Philadelphia - will focus on research needed to manage carbon in the built environment.
